Introduction About Busan International Film Festival (BIFF)

The Busan International Film Festival (BIFF) is one of the most prestigious film festivals in Asia held annually in Busan South Korea. It was established in 1996 & has since become a meaningfull event in the global film industry. BIFF showcases a wide range of films from all over the world including independent & art house films as well as mainstream blockbusters. The festival aims to promote cultural exchange & appreciation of cinema while also providing a platform for emerging filmmakers to showcase their work. BIFF is a must visit event for film enthusiasts & industry professionals alike offering a diverse & exciting lineup of films every year.

Date & Timing About Busan International Film Festival (BIFF)

The Busan International Film Festival (BIFF) usually takes place in October every year with the exact dates being determined by the organizers based on various factors such as the availability of venues film submissions & the schedules of filmmakers & industry professionals. The festival typically runs for around 10 days showcasing a diverse range of films from around the world & attracting film enthusiasts industry professionals & celebrities to the city of Busan in South Korea. Intresting Facts About Busan International Film Festival (BIFF)

Did you know that the Busan International Film Festival (BIFF) is not only the largest film festival in South Korea but also one of the most prestigious in Asia? The festival which was first held in 1996 showcases a wide range of films from around the world with a special focus on Asian cinema. One unique custom of BIFF is the outdoor screenings held at the famous Haeundae Beach where moviegoers can enjoy films under the stars. Another interesting fact is that BIFF is known for its support of up & coming filmmakers with a special section dedicated to showcasing debut films.
